A Power BI Gateway is a software component that enables the seamless and secure transfer of data between on-premises data sources and the cloud-based Power BI service. It acts as a bridge that facilitates the flow of information, allowing organizations to leverage their existing data sources while benefitting from the advanced analytics capabilities of Power BI.

Overview:

In today’s data-driven world, organizations heavily rely on data analysis to gain valuable insights and make informed business decisions. Power BI, a popular business intelligence tool developed by Microsoft, enables users to visualize and analyze data from various sources in a user-friendly and interactive manner. However, not all data resides in the cloud, as many organizations still maintain on-premises data sources. This is where the Power BI Gateway comes into play.

The Power BI Gateway serves as a secure and efficient conduit between on-premises data sources and the Power BI service in the cloud. It allows organizations to establish a connection between their on-premises data repositories, such as databases or file systems, and the Power BI cloud service. By doing so, users can combine and analyze data from both on-premises and cloud-based sources within the same Power BI environment, enabling comprehensive insights that span across various data sets.

Advantages:

  1. Data Privacy and Security: The Power BI Gateway ensures that sensitive data remains protected, as it establishes an encrypted and secure connection between the on-premises data sources and the cloud service. This allows organizations to leverage the benefits of cloud-based analytics while maintaining confidentiality.
  2. Real-time Data Refresh: The Gateway enables real-time or scheduled data refreshes, ensuring that the data presented in Power BI reports and dashboards is up to date. Users can configure refresh intervals according to their specific requirements, ensuring that the insights derived from the data are always accurate and timely.
  3. Scalability and Performance: By utilizing the Power BI Gateway, organizations can leverage their on-premises infrastructure investments while benefiting from the scalability and performance capabilities of the cloud. The Gateway optimizes data transfer and query execution, resulting in faster and more efficient data analysis.

Applications:

The Power BI Gateway finds valuable applications across a wide range of industries and business scenariOS . Here are a few examples:

  1. Finance and Accounting: Organizations can use the Gateway to securely connect their financial data stored in on-premises systems to Power BI, enabling comprehensive financial analytics, budgeting, and forecasting.
  2. Healthcare: Healthcare providers can utilize the Gateway to integrate data from electronic health records (EHRs), medical devices, and other healthcare systems, empowering them to gain actionable insights for patient care, resource allocation, and operational efficiency.
  3. Manufacturing: The Gateway facilitates the seamless integration of data from operational technology systems, such as supervisory control and data acquisition (SCADA) or manufacturing execution systems (MES), with Power BI. This allows manufacturers to monitor and analyze real-time production data, optimize processes, and identify areas for improvement.
